Identifying Unlicensed Brokers: Tips and Best Practices
To avoid falling prey to investment scams, it is essential to be aware of the warning signs associated with unlicensed brokers. Some key indicators include:
- Missing license information: Legitimate brokers always display their licensure and regulatory information prominently.
- Fake credentials: Be cautious of platforms that claim to have certifications or affiliations that cannot be verified.
- Unrealistic promises: If an investment opportunity seems too good to be true, it likely is.
- Poor customer support: Reputable brokers prioritize customer support and provide clear, concise communication.
Steps to Take After Falling for a Scam
If you have fallen victim to an investment scam, such as Blockdag Trade, it is crucial to take prompt action to minimize potential damage. The following steps can help:
- Stop all communication: Cease all interactions with the scammer, including phone calls, emails, and messages.
- Report the scam: Inform relevant authorities, such as the Federal Trade Commission (FTC) or your local consumer protection agency, about the scam.
- Contact your bank or payment provider: Notify your bank or payment provider about the unauthorized transactions and request their assistance in recovering your funds.
- Consider identity theft protection: If you have provided personal or financial information to the scammer, consider enlisting the services of an identity theft protection agency.
- Warn others: Share your experience through reviews and scam reporting websites to help prevent others from falling victim to the same scam.
